Subscribe CTAs That Actually Convert

Generic 'subscribe' CTAs get ignored. Effective CTAs explain the benefit: 'Subscribe for weekly tutorials that will help you [specific goal].' Tell viewers what they'll get and how often. Specificity converts better than generic requests.

Engagement CTAs: Asking Questions That Get Responses

Engagement CTAs need specific, easy-to-answer questions. 'What's your experience with [topic]?' gets more responses than 'Let me know what you think.' Specific questions are easier to answer. Reading and responding to comments boosts engagement further.

Like CTAs: Explaining Why It Matters

Viewers don't care about likes until you explain the benefit. 'A like helps this reach more people who need it' gives viewers a reason. 'If this helped you, hit like' ties the action to value received. Explain the why, not just the what.

Next Video CTAs: Keeping Viewers on Your Channel

Next video CTAs boost session time, which YouTube rewards. 'If you want to learn [related topic], watch this video next' provides clear value. Link to relevant videos, not random content. Viewers stay when the next video solves their next problem.

Value-First CTAs: Giving Before Asking

Value-first CTAs give extra value before asking for anything. 'Here's a bonus tip: [value]. If you found this helpful, subscribe.' This approach feels less pushy and converts better because you've already over-delivered on value.

CTA Timing: When to Ask for Engagement

CTA timing matters. Subscribe CTAs work best after you've delivered value (mid-video or end). Like CTAs work at the end. Comment CTAs work mid-video when you ask questions. Next video CTAs work at the very end. Match CTA type to video moment.

What is the most effective YouTube CTA (Call-to-Action)?

A 'Value-Based' CTA is best: 'Subscribe if you want to learn [Benefit] every week.' By connecting the action to a clear personal benefit for the viewer, you significantly increase your subscriber conversion rate.

Where should I place CTAs in my video script?

Use 'Micro-CTAs' in the first 30% (soft ask) and a 'Final CTA' at the end. Don't crowd the middle of your video with asks, as this can break the 'Value Flow' and cause viewers to leave early.

How do I scripts a 'Comment Prompt' that actually works?

Ask a specific, low-friction question: 'Do you prefer A or B?' or 'What's the #1 problem you're facing with [Topic]?'. Specific questions are much easier for viewers to answer than a generic 'Tell me your thoughts.'

Should I script an 'End Screen' CTA?

Yes, explicitly tell viewers which video to watch next: 'If you liked this, you'll love my guide on [Topic]—click it right here.' Directing traffic to a related video increases 'Session Time,' which is a major ranking signal for YouTube.

How do I write a 'Support the Channel' CTA script?

Be transparent about why you need support (e.g., 'to keep these reviews independent'). Connect their support directly to the quality of future content, which builds a sense of partnership and community with your audience.

Can I use 'Scarcity' or 'Urgency' in a CTA script?

Yes, for limited offers or timely content: 'Download this free guide before the [Event] starts.' Urgency motivates viewers to take immediate action, improving your conversion rates for lead magnets and external links.
